Why Commercial Outdoor Lighting Is Essential

Outdoor lighting is not just about improving the appearance of a commercial property. 

For businesses, office buildings, retail centers, hotels, restaurants, apartment communities, and other commercial spaces, proper lighting plays an important role in safety, security, customer experience, and property value. 

A well-planned lighting system helps people move around the property with confidence, makes the building easier to identify after dark, and creates a more professional first impression.

Commercial properties often have multiple outdoor areas that need reliable visibility, including parking lots, walkways, entrances, signage, loading zones, patios, and landscaped areas. 

When these spaces are poorly lit, the property can feel unsafe, neglected, or difficult to navigate. 

With the help of an experienced outdoor lighting company, business owners and property managers can create a lighting system that supports both function and appearance.

Improved Safety

Safety is one of the most important reasons commercial properties need proper outdoor lighting. 

Walkways, stairs, ramps, curbs, parking lots, and building entrances should be clearly visible for employees, tenants, customers, and visitors. 

When these areas are dark or unevenly lit, people may have difficulty seeing obstacles, changes in elevation, or potential hazards.

A professionally designed lighting system helps reduce these risks by improving visibility in high-traffic areas. 

This is especially important for businesses that operate in the early morning, evening, or overnight hours. 

Proper lighting allows people to enter, exit, and move around the property more comfortably, creating a safer environment for everyone who uses the space.

Enhanced Security

Commercial outdoor lighting also plays a major role in property security. 

Dark corners, hidden entry points, unlit parking lots, and shadowed areas around a building can make a property more vulnerable to trespassing, vandalism, theft, and unwanted activity. 

Bright, strategic lighting helps reduce these blind spots and makes the property less attractive to intruders.

Security lighting can also improve the performance of surveillance cameras. 

When outdoor spaces are properly illuminated, cameras can capture clearer footage, making it easier to monitor activity around entrances, parking areas, loading zones, and building perimeters. 

For property managers, this added visibility helps create a stronger sense of control and protection after dark.

Professional Curb Appeal

First impressions matter for commercial properties. 

A dark or poorly lit exterior can make a business look closed, outdated, or unwelcoming, even when the property is well maintained during the day. 

Strategically placed outdoor lighting can highlight entrances, signage, landscaping, architectural details, and pathways to create a polished and professional appearance.

For restaurants, hotels, retail centers, office buildings, medical offices, and luxury commercial spaces, curb appeal can influence how customers and clients feel before they walk inside. 

A well-lit exterior makes the property look more inviting, organized, and trustworthy. It also helps reinforce the quality and professionalism of the business.

Operational Efficiency

Proper outdoor lighting allows commercial properties to function better after dark. 

Many businesses rely on outdoor areas for customer parking, evening appointments, outdoor dining, deliveries, employee access, events, and building maintenance. 

Without enough lighting, these spaces may become difficult or unsafe to use once the sun goes down.

A well-designed commercial lighting system helps businesses make better use of their property throughout the day and evening. 

It supports smoother operations, improves convenience for customers and employees, and allows outdoor spaces to remain practical beyond daylight hours. 

This is especially valuable for properties with extended business hours or high evening traffic.

Brand Visibility

Outdoor lighting helps commercial properties stay visible and recognizable at night. 

Signage, entrances, monument signs, storefronts, landscape features, and architectural elements can all be highlighted with the right lighting design. 

This makes it easier for customers, clients, tenants, and visitors to locate the property quickly.

Strong nighttime visibility also helps a business stand out in competitive areas. 

When several businesses are located close together, a well-lit property can attract attention and create a more memorable impression. 

Accent lighting and landscape lighting can support the brand image by making the property look clean, professional, and well cared for.

Energy Efficiency

Modern commercial outdoor lighting can also improve energy efficiency. 

Older lighting systems may use outdated fixtures, inefficient bulbs, or poor placement that wastes energy without providing better visibility. 

LED lighting and properly designed layouts can deliver strong illumination while using less power.

An experienced outdoor lighting company can recommend energy-efficient fixtures and placement strategies that help reduce unnecessary energy use. 

This is especially important for large properties with parking lots, long walkways, multiple entrances, and extensive landscaping. 

A better lighting system can improve performance while helping control long-term operating costs.

Long-Term Durability

Commercial outdoor lighting must be built to handle daily use, weather exposure, moisture, landscaping equipment, and changing outdoor conditions. 

Low-quality fixtures or poor installation can lead to frequent repairs, uneven lighting, and early system failure. This can create both safety concerns and ongoing maintenance costs.

Professional commercial lighting systems are designed with durable fixtures, proper wiring, weather-resistant materials, and reliable installation methods. 

This helps the system perform consistently throughout the year and keeps the property looking professional after dark. 

Durable lighting is especially important for businesses that depend on a clean, safe, and welcoming exterior every day.

Key Considerations When Choosing an Outdoor Lighting Company

Custom Commercial Landscape Lighting Designs

Every property has unique layouts, landscaping, and architectural elements. 

Custom design ensures that your commercial outdoor lighting solutions highlight entrances, parking lots, and outdoor spaces in ways that enhance functionality and aesthetics. 

A professional company evaluates your property, plans fixture placement, and recommends lighting that blends with existing landscaping.

Energy Efficiency and Low Maintenance

Energy efficiency is vital for large commercial properties. Ask if they use LED lighting, which consumes less energy, has a longer lifespan, and requires less maintenance than traditional bulbs. 

Long-lasting, weather-resistant fixtures are crucial for commercial properties exposed to harsh elements.

Security-Focused Lighting

Commercial properties require lighting for safety and security. 

A quality outdoor lighting company designs systems including perimeter lights, motion sensors, and pathway illumination. 

Ask how the company ensures even coverage, reduces dark spots, and integrates with surveillance cameras.

Ongoing Maintenance and Support

Even high-quality lighting systems need upkeep. Professional companies offer maintenance plans including fixture cleaning, bulb replacement, and seasonal adjustments. 

Confirm if they provide emergency repair services or system updates to maximize longevity and reliability.

Integration with Existing Landscapes or Structures

Retrofitting lighting into existing commercial properties can be challenging. 

Ensure the company can integrate fixtures seamlessly into hardscapes, gardens, or architectural features without causing damage or requiring costly modifications.

Project Timeline and Installation Process

A reputable company should provide a clear plan: a free on-site consultation to understand property layout and objectives, custom lighting design tailored to your property and security needs. 

You can also get professional installation by licensed and insured technicians, and a final walkthrough with system testing to ensure functionality and satisfaction.

Specialty or Permanent Holiday Lighting Options

Some properties benefit from specialty lighting to highlight architectural features or outdoor seating areas. 

Decorative or Permanent holiday lighting enhances the ambiance and branding, offering year-round benefits without repeated installations.

Remote Control and Smart Features

Modern commercial lighting often includes smart controls, allowing you to program schedules, adjust brightness, and monitor performance from mobile apps or central systems. 

Remote management saves energy and ensures lighting adapts to operational needs.

Verifying Experience and References

Experience matters. Request references or case studies showing similar projects. 

Companies familiar with Metro Atlanta regulations, building codes, and commercial property layouts will provide smoother installation and better results.

FAQs

What types of outdoor lighting are best for commercial properties?

Commercial properties benefit from a combination of perimeter lighting, pathway illumination, parking lot lighting, and accent lighting. Together, these systems improve safety, security, and professional appearance.

How long do commercial outdoor lighting systems last?

Professional LED commercial lighting systems can last 10–20 years with proper maintenance. Durability depends on fixture quality, weather conditions, and maintenance schedules.

Can outdoor lighting reduce energy costs?

Yes, Modern LED systems use significantly less electricity than traditional bulbs, and smart controls allow automated scheduling, minimizing energy consumption during off-hours.

Is it possible to retrofit lighting into an existing property?

Experienced outdoor lighting companies can integrate new systems seamlessly into existing landscapes, hardscapes, and building structures without major disruptions or damage.

How often should maintenance be performed?

Commercial lighting should be inspected 1–2 times per year. Regular maintenance includes cleaning fixtures, replacing bulbs, checking wiring, and adjusting placements for optimal coverage.

Are permanent holiday or specialty lighting options available?

Yes, Many companies offer permanent holiday lighting, firefly section lighting, and accent systems to enhance ambiance or branding year-round.

Can lighting systems be controlled remotely?

Modern systems often include smart controls or timers, allowing remote adjustments, scheduling, and monitoring from mobile devices or central systems.

How do I verify a company’s experience?

Request references, case studies, and examples of previous commercial installations. An experienced provider will demonstrate familiarity with local building codes, property types, and large-scale installations.

What should I expect during installation?

Expect a consultation, custom design, professional installation, and a final walkthrough with support for system adjustments and maintenance guidance.
